Transaction 104a25ef6d7490fb6788cb7ed3bedd0a7eb7c93f917e5fcfc263fccc86a5636f
1 Input
1 Output
-
104a25ef6d7490fb6788cb7ed3bedd0a7eb7c93f917e5fcfc263fccc86a5636f:0
- value
- 17479383
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 adfcb124be0d760a6a479fecf22e6aa9dcd64eae OP_EQUALVERIFY OP_CHECKSIG
- address
- 1GrxcXsjgFkjvFEGYAwjrkHvNtE6JAoMHR